Investment group Babcock & Brown Ltd says it has received expressions of interest from a number of parties about setting up strategic relationships.
The firm said it will review the proposals and that there is no certainty an agreement will eventuate.
B&B is undertaking "a process to review the expressions of interest it has received from a number of parties to establish a strategic relationship with the firm.
"The process is at a preliminary stage and there is no certainty that any agreement will eventuate.
"As the process has only recently commenced, no formal timetable for resolution of any agreement has yet been determined although Babcock & Brown would expect the process to continue into the new year."
Earlier this week, B&B managed investment fund Babcock & Brown Power Ltd, which owns the retail arm of Alinta, said it would seek a takeover suitor or buyers to snap up strategic packages of its assets.
